Cafe Pharma: The Web Equivalent of the Men’s Room Wall?

Cafe Pharma (or Cafepharma) can be a great source of news on the pharma industry for sales reps.  However, it can also be less than professional and extremely negative.  Although maybe I’m understating…here’s a link to an article that calls Cafe Pharmaceutical the “cyberspace equivalent of scrawls on a men’s room wall.”  (I do enjoy a wonderful turn of phrase.)  It’s home to rumors, accusations, racism, misogyny–that’s helpful, huh?  (read with sarcasm, please)

Pharmaceutical reps are already the least respected of all areas of clinical sales–behind pharma sales, biotech revenue, clinical device sales, imaging sales, clinical laboratory revenue, and clinical diagnostics sales.  Some of it’s intrinsic to the career opportunity, but chat room ranting doesn’t help.
